Skip to content

I want a more powerful, standardized, cross‑browser API that gives developers deeper access to device capabilities—especially sensors, system‑level features, and hardware integrations—without requiring platform‑specific hacks or permissions workarounds. #815

@WebWeWantBot

Description

@WebWeWantBot

title: I want a more powerful, standardized, cross‑browser API that gives developers deeper access to device capabilities—especially sensors, system‑level features, and hardware integrations—without requiring platform‑specific hacks or permissions workarounds.
date: 2026-01-17T01:18:15.855Z
submitter: PRIVATE
number: 696ae35763afb7f80f137d88
tags: [ ]
discussion: https://github.com/WebWeWant/webwewant.fyi/discussions/
status: [ discussing || in-progress || complete ]
related:

  • title:
    url:
    type: [ article || explainer || draft || spec || note || discussion ]

Right now, building modern web experiences often hits a wall because browsers expose only limited device features. For example, accessing advanced sensors, clipboard formats, file system operations, background tasks, or system‑level automation is inconsistent or unavailable across browsers. This forces developers to rely on:

polyfills that break unpredictably

browser‑specific flags

native wrappers like Electron or Capacitor

or abandoning the web platform entirely for mobile apps

This limitation slows down development, increases maintenance cost, and prevents the web from competing with native platforms. A unified, secure, permission‑based API layer—supported across all major browsers—would unlock huge potential for productivity tools, creative apps, automation workflows, and accessibility features.


If posted, this will appear at https://webwewant.fyi/wants/696ae35763afb7f80f137d88/

Metadata

Metadata

Assignees

No one assigned

    Labels

    triage-neededwantIncoming requests from the community

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ions